Harold Thomson, of Rockglen, SK, passed away March 24, 2018 at age 85. He was predeceased by his parents, Willie & Ida (Mergel) Thomson. Harold is survived by his wife Betty (Kimball); three children: Ellen (Shan) Noyes, Jody (Rae) Thomson and Rory (Olga) Thomson; eight grandchildren; two great-grandchildren; brother Billy (Maxine) Thomson, as well as numerous nieces, nephews and other relatives. Harold was born October 27, 1932 at the Red Cross Hospital at the Old Post, Wood Mountain, SK. He grew up on the ranch in the Wood Mountain / Canopus area. He and his brother attended Bayard, Guildford, Sunnycrest, and Old Post, Wood Mountain Schools. Harold built bridges and roads for the L.I.D.’s from Rockglen to the Alberta border for eleven summers. In the 1960’s he owned a caterpillar tractor and scraper and did custom work. Harold married Elizabeth ‘Betty’ Kimball in 1964. They resided on their ranch seven miles northwest of Canopus. His hobbies were karate which he started when he was fifty and practiced for over 10 years, hunting or just observing the wildlife and training horses. He loved his ranch and lived there until he was 80 and health problems meant he couldn't be alone. Then he moved into Rockglen. He was actively farming and helping to care for the livestock up until he moved to Rockglen.
